The total number of SDS nodes
|
n SDS nodes have membership state 'Joined'
|
The number of SDS nodes that are connected to the cluster, can receive I/O, and hold primary and secondary copies of data.
It takes some time from actual disconnection until the SDS is disconnected from the cluster, or the reverse. There are also up-pending and down-pending states.
|
n SDS nodes have connection state 'Connected'
|
The number of SDS nodes currently connected to the MDM
|
x TB (y GB) total capacity
|
The total amount of available raw storage
This does not represent the total capacity available for volume allocation.
|
x TB (y GB) unused capacity
|
The quantity of raw capacity in the system that can be earmarked for specific purposes, such as Spare, or used for new volume creation
|
x Bytes snapshots capacity
|
The quantity of capacity used for storing snapshots
|
x TB (y GB) in-use capacity
|
The total quantity of healthy, degraded, and failed capacity
|
x Bytes thin capacity
|
The quantity of capacity currently needed for storage purposes
|
x TB (y GB) protected capacity
|
The quantity of capacity that is fully protected (primary and secondary copies of the data exist)
|
x Bytes failed capacity
|
The quantity of capacity that is not available at all (neither primary, nor secondary copies)
|
x Bytes degraded-failed capacity
|
The quantity of degraded-failed capacity. When an SDS fails, all of its capacity is defined as degraded-failed, and the secondary copies (which are spread across the Protection Domain) are defined as degraded-healthy.
|
x Bytes degraded-healthy capacity
|
The quantity of degraded-healthy capacity. When an SDS fails, all of its capacity is defined as degraded-failed, and the secondary copies (which are spread across the Protection Domain) are defined as degraded-healthy.
|
x Bytes unreachable-unused capacity
|
The quantity of capacity not configured for any use type in the system that is currently unavailable
|
x Bytes active rebalance capacity
|
The quantity of capacity that is currently being migrated to a different location for load balancing purposes
|
x Bytes pending rebalance capacity
|
The quantity of capacity that is waiting in the job queue for migration to a different location for load balancing purposes
|
x Bytes active forward-rebuild capacity
|
The quantity of capacity for which one copy of data exists and a second copy is currently being created
|
x Bytes pending forward-rebuild capacity
|
The quantity of capacity for which one copy of data exists, and a job for the creation of a second copy is waiting in the job queue
|
x Bytes active backward-rebuild capacity
|
The quantity of capacity for which one copy of data went offline and came back online, and changes are currently being synchronized in that copy
|
x Bytes pending backward-rebuild capacity
|
The quantity of capacity for which one copy of data went offline and came back online, and changes are waiting in the job queue to be synchronized in that copy
|
x Bytes rebalance capacity
|
The total quantity of capacity that is either currently rebalancing or is pending Rebalance
|
x Bytes forward-rebuild capacity
|
The total quantity of degraded capacity that is either currently in Forward Rebuild state or is pending Forward Rebuild
|
x Bytes backward-rebuild capacity
|
The total quantity of degraded capacity that is either currently in Backward Rebuild state or is pending Backward Rebuild
|
x Bytes active moving capacity
|
The quantity of capacity that is currently being migrated from one location to another
|
x Bytes pending moving capacity
|
The quantity of capacity that is waiting in the job queue for migration from one location to another
|
x Bytes total moving capacity
|
The total quantity of active and pending moving (migrating) capacity
|
x TB (y GB) spare capacity
|
The quantity of capacity that is reserved for system use when recovery from failure is required. This capacity cannot be used for storage purposes.
|
x TB (y GB) at-rest capacity
|
The quantity of capacity that is fully protected and not in a Rebuild or Rebalance state
